A regular schedule of games has been arranged for the interclass squash teams and the various basketball league teams.
Until January 11, the four class squash squads will play a tournament. Each man will be given the opportunity to challenge the man above him on the list, and the seven best players from each squad will form the class teams. After that, a series of interclass matches will be played, running till March 4. Four days will be allowed to play off a match.
The newly formed basketball league of class teams and graduate school teams will also get under way tomorrow at 3 o'clock when the first year law men clash with the first year Business School team.
